We have an exciting opportunity for an experienced surgeon with a surgical bias to join our practice. We have a wide and varied caseload and the facilities waiting for you to fully develop your skills and potential. We also have the support needed for an experienced vet wanting to study towards certificate level.

Our practice is an RCVS registered hospital and surgery, split over two sites on the Norfolk/Suffolk coast. The area is within the Norfolk Broads and offers beautiful surroundings, whilst maintaining a reasonable commute to London. We host a MiNightVets out of hour's service, providing 24-hour onsite care for our patients. We also run a radioactive iodine referral service, accepting referrals from the wider region.

We have a visiting Cardiologist and the following equipment/facilities available:

  • Radioactive iodine unit
  • 4 fully equipped theatres
  • Full orthopaedic kit including TPLO and TTA plates
  • Lap spay kit
  • Ultrasound and Echocardiography at each site
  • EPOC, lactate, blood/plasma storage site for pet blood bank
  • Video assisted bronchoscopy/endoscopy
  • DR X-ray system
  • Elixir kit for toxicology emergencies
  • Separate dog/cat kennels and large well equipped isolation facilities
  • Fully equipped onsite lab, including endocrine testing

We are looking for a vet that has an interest in surgery who is keen to support our surgical caseload and develop their surgical skills. We would provide full development opportunities with two full operating days per week alongside consulting days, support to study a certificate, external/internal CPD tailored to your needs and support from other clinicians.

A full-time position is worked over 4 days, with 1 in 4 Saturday mornings. Weekends, bank holidays and nights are covered by the on-site Minightvet service. Out of hours shifts can be available for anyone interested in ECC work. We are fully supportive of flexible working opportunities and exploring the right fit for you.

Salary up to £70,000 depending on experience. We would love to hear from you and discuss what you are looking for.
